Pathfinder Programme - funding reallocations

From: Cabinet - Thursday, 26th June, 2025 7.00 pm - June 26, 2025

The requirement to reallocate funding within the Simplification Pathfinder Pilot programme from the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government, following the formal decision to close the Pathfinder Port Infrastructure project, within the Green Port Intervention.   The funding reallocation was for the Green Campus, Clock House, Harbour Placemaking, Broad Street, Fishing Facilities and to Contingency.   As the Accountable Body for the projects within the Simplification Pathfinder Pilot, the council is the ultimate decision maker.

Port of Ramsgate - Future Delivery Project

From: Cabinet - Thursday, 26th June, 2025 7.00 pm - June 26, 2025

A report was presented to Cabinet to update on the Port of Ramsgate Future Delivery Project which focuses upon the long term sustainability of the Port of Ramsgate. This includes the concession operator procurement process which started in August 2024 and was formally abandoned in January 2025.   The report recommended that previously approved plans to implement a concession port operator model, supported by a grant from Pathfinder funding, be formally ended. The report set out that this proposal did not change the overarching objectives for the port, which include ending the revenue deficit position and delivering a sustainable solution for the port in the long term.   The report also recommended that further options be developed to deliver a sustainable long term solution for the port, with those options being brought back to Cabinet in the autumn of 2025.   The report also described the rationale for reallocating £7.6m of Ramsgate Pathfinder funding away from the Port Future Delivery Project due to the deadline for spending that funding. That recommendation is the subject of a separate report to Cabinet.
